#150ab4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#150ab4 is composed of 8.2% red, 3.9% green and 70.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.3% cyan, 94.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 243.9 degrees, a saturation of 89.5% and a lightness of 37.3%. #150ab4 color hex could be obtained by blending #2a14ff with #000069. Closest websafe color is: #0000cc.

Shades and Tints of #150ab4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01010d is the darkest color, while #faf9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#150ab4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5b5a64 is the less saturated color, while #0f03bb is the most saturated one.
